The Fragility of DOGE’s Value Proposition

Dogecoin’s recent 5% price decline in August 2025 underscored its structural vulnerabilities. Despite whale accumulation of 680 million

tokens, the coin’s value remains tethered to retail sentiment and macroeconomic conditions, with 27.7% of its circulating supply controlled by large holders [1]. This concentration creates volatility, as evidenced by the 96% drop in daily active addresses from July’s peak [2]. Meanwhile, a $4.6 million outflow from DOGE to Remittix (RTX) in August signaled a broader rotation toward projects with deflationary tokenomics and infrastructure [2]. For investors, DOGE’s reliance on speculative momentum—rather than utility—highlights its limited potential in a maturing crypto market.
